About Ethox Chemicals

Ethox Chemicals is a specialty chemical manufacturer headquartered in Greenville, South Carolina. As part of the Syntha Group, a privately held, fourth-generation family-owned company, Ethox combines entrepreneurial agility with the resources and stability of a larger organization. Syntha Group operates six manufacturing facilities across the southern United States and has built a reputation for innovation, quality, customer service, and long-term business relationships.

At Ethox, we develop and manufacture specialty chemical solutions that serve a diverse range of industrial markets including Agriculture, Personal & Home Care, Paints & Coatings, Metalworking, Oil & Gas, and Textiles.
